North Macedonia’s KF Shkendija faced Turkish side Samsunspor in a high-intensity UEFA Europa Conference League play-off first leg clash at the Todor Proeski Arena in Skopje on February 19, 2026.
During a fiercely contested moment, Shkendija defender Anes Meljichi (26) challenged Samsunspor forward Pape Cherif Ndiaye (19) as both players battled for possession under the floodlights. The physical duel reflected the competitive edge and high stakes of the European fixture, with each side determined to secure an advantage ahead of the decisive return leg.
